Hi All,
I have a laptop Dell d600 P4. I shutdown and brought the laptop home from work. When i tried powering the laptop up it has the two lights on Power, Hard disk, stays on for 3 seconds and then switches itself off. I have attempted the following, taking the battery out and blowing on the contacts putting the battery back in, checked the memory modules were seated correctly, they were, took the hard disk out and put back in restarted machine but still get the same problem stays on for three seconds and then switches itself off. Please could someone help as this is very important. Kind Regards. -- Peter Are you able to try with a mains pwr adapter?
If this occurs before any post, sound kinda terminal, ie a switch problem?
